President Michael D. Higgins attends major climate change summit in Paris

21 July 2015

President Michael D. Higgins addressed the ‘Summit of Consciences for the Climate’ on Tuesday, 21st July at the Economic, Social and Environmental Council in Paris. President Higgins was one of four keynote speakers who delivered opening remarks at the conference. The other speakers were President Hollande, former Secretary General of the United Nations, Kofi Annan, and Prince Albert of Monaco.

Ireland passes marriage equality referendum

27 May 2015

On 22 May 2015, Ireland became the first country in the world to vote for equal marriage in a referendum. The proposal was supported by 62% of voters, or 1.2 million people. The Taoiseach Enda Kenny and Tánaiste Joan Burton spoke following the result on the significance of the vote for Ireland.

Visit by French Prime Minister Manuel Valls to Dublin

24 April 2015

French Prime Minister Manuel Valls travelled to Dublin for a two visit on 23-24 April. In the course of the visit, Mr Valls met with Taoiseach Enda Kenny and Tánaiste Joan Burton as well as key Irish business and political figures and attended a ceremony to inaugurate the new Embassy of France in Ireland in Merrion Square.

Taoiseach attends Solidarity March in Paris

11 January 2015

Taoiseach Enda Kenny travelled to Paris on 11 January to join President Hollande and the French people in the march of solidarity. Speaking after the march, the Taoiseach expressed his condolences and support for the French government and the French people.
